Cerro Centinela
Cerro Centinela is a peak in Pichilemu, Cardenal Caro Province, O’Higgins Region and has an elevation of 594 metres.| Tap on a place to explore it |

San Antonio de Petrel
Hamlet
San Antonio de Petrel is a small Chilean village located near the hacienda of the same name, in Pichilemu. It is located 18 kilometres east of Pichilemu. San Antonio de Petrel is situated 10 km west of Cerro Centinela.
